JOB DUTIES As a process operator at the heating plant, you will deliver district heating to the company's customers. We also deliver waste heat from LKAB. You will work alongside a colleague as shifts are double-staffed, utilizing what's known as a five-shift system. The role includes optimizing our production facilities, starting and stopping boilers, the turbine and auxiliary systems, as well as supervision including rounds, corrective and preventive maintenance. Since Kiruna Kraft is undergoing a major transition that will phase out waste incineration and replace it primarily with waste heat, the position will eventually involve daytime work with varied tasks. These will include maintenance and leak detection on the network during summer and increasingly throughout the year. Sameskolstyrelsen is a state authority with its office, school principal, controllers, HR, and case officers in Jåhkåmåhkke. Sameskolan is an educational form equivalent to primary school with instruction from preschool class through grade 6. The basis for instruction is Sámi culture and the Sámi language according to the curriculum for Sameskolan. Sameskolstyrelsen also operates preschools in agreement with respective municipalities. Sameskolstyrelsen has operations in Giron, Gárasavvon, Váhtjer, Jåhkåmåhkke, and Dearna. Sameskolstyrelsen provides distance learning in the Sámi languages and supports the development and production of teaching materials for Sámi instruction. 1 position(s). Kiruna Malmförädling's mission is to process ore from the mine into finished product. The main parts of the process are screening, concentration, and pelletizing. The department consists of a total of eight sections, four of which are part of the main process and the remaining four are support sections for quality, technology and process development, material processes, and maintenance.
